Afghanistan's currency fell to its lowest value against the US dollar since 2001 on Monday.
One dollar was sold for 71.10 afghanis during the day, which is the lowest since January 2001 when one dollar was sold for 76.96 afghanis. Amin Jan Khosti, a member of Afghanistan Money Dealers Union, said that insecurity and political instability are main reasons behind fall in the value of afghani. He also blamed “weakness in central bank’s management” for the problem. This comes as the central bank has decreased the level of selling dollars in the country’s markets. With the fall in the value of afghani, prices of food items, especially rice, flour and oil have increased. The central bank declined to make comment on the matter.

Taliban insurgents killed 32 police overnight in Afghanistan's southern province of Zabul, sources told 1TV Saturday.
It happened after militants attacked checkpoints in Arghandab district. Ata Jan Haq Bayan, head of provincial council, said that the insurgents seized four checkpoints. He confirmed death of 22 police and wounding of seven others. Zabul has suffered heavy clashes in recent days in its Daichopan, Mizana, Arghandab and Naw Bahar. The official warned of fall of districts if assistance is not delivered. The latest violence in Zabul comes a day after Taliban killed dozens of police in western Farah province.
